Job Description

•A minimum of 5 years of professional experience in software development•Strong knowledge of Object-Oriented Analysis and Design, Software Design Patterns •Strong Java and/or C++ software design, implementation and testing skills •Experience or studies related to distributed systems, peer-to-peer ne...

Apply for this Position

Ready to join Tata Consultancy Services? Click the button below to submit your application.

Submit Application